Since our beginnings in 1972, WMM has grown from a feminist filmmakers' collective into an industry-leading nonprofit media arts organization and distributor. For 40 years, WMM has transformed the landscape of filmmaking for women directors and producers, bringing the issues facing women around the world to screens everywhere. Now, with more than 550 films in our catalog, including Academy®, Emmy®, Peabody and Sundance nominees and award winners, WMM is the largest distributor of films by independent women directors in the world. In the last five years, dozens of WMM films have been broadcast on PBS, HBO and the Sundance Channel, among others. 
NEW FROM WMM: SISTERS IN ARMS!

"First to probe deep into Canadian female combat veterans' experience." -The Wall Street Journal 

Canada is one of a handful of countries that permit women to fight in ground combat. This award-winning documentary reveals the untold stories of three remarkable women who have taken on the military's most difficult and dangerous professions, fighting on the front lines in Afghanistan. Through video diary and intimate personal interviews, SISTERS IN ARMS tells stories of loss and inspiration from a uniquely female perspective, challenging perceptions of what constitutes a soldier. Women make up 15% of today's military, a number expected to double in the next 10 years. SERVICE: WHEN WOMEN COME MARCHING HOME follows seven amazing women representing the first wave of mothers, daughters and sisters returning home from active duty. This eye-opening documentary traces perilous journeys from war torn Middle-Eastern deserts to alienating American streets, from coping with PTSD, homelessness, and the devastating effects of sexual trauma to the rebuilding of civilian lives alongside the heartfelt support of fellow veterans.
